The list of providers we’re working on bringing into the mix is getting longer every day, but the bottom line is that right now, the network is already quite Uber.
For the record, here is the complete list of current providers:
Level(3)
Savvis
Global Crossing
Qwest
Sprint
AT&T
Telia
BTN/PCCW
Time Warner
WBS
Charter
Nuvox
ERC Broadband
We have open negotiations with a dozen other providers and once we reach acceptable agreements, we’ll be adding them in to the mix as well. Our plans for the future are big. We’re running fiber to other carrier hotels around the United States and by the end of 2009 we hope to directly peer with over 100 networks.
